Farioli says the semi-final should have been against Santa Clara or AVS

Imagen del artículo:Farioli says the semi-final should have been against Santa Clara or AVS

After having criticized Cláudio Pereira’s performance in the quick interview with Sport TV, Francesco Farioli spoke to RTP Notícias microphones and was even more incisive in listing what he considers irregular in tonight’s classic at Alvalade against Sporting.

“Tonight there are many clear images. The Sporting player deliberately hits Bednarek, with the ball far from the area of play, just to injure and hurt him. That’s a red card and a few more games out. It’s unbelievable and it’s very funny that they’re doing this because today we should be playing against Santa Clara or AVS SAD… At the end of the first half, right in front of the camera, there are words from Sporting players directed at the referees with no room for interpretation. It’s inconceivable how they allow a great player like Hjulmand to approach the referees like that in every play… Honestly, it’s embarrassing just to watch. But it is what it is. Now it’s time to turn the page and prepare for the match against Benfica.”
